Lincoln are our oldest rivals (we've been playing them pretty regularly for over 130 years in the Lincs Cup, if nowhere else!), but I've never considered it a bitter rivalry.

Truth be told, I don't really mind how they are doing, as long as it doesn't affect us and I feel much the same way about Scunny as well. I suppose this is because they were both generally a couple of divisions beneath us for much of the time I've been watching GTFC.

On the other hand, the Tahgers were a couple of divisions below us for most of that time as well, but I'm always pleased to see them lose, regardless of where they are playing. This is because I seem to have inherited my Dad's dislike for the place!
